Trinidad and Tobago Carnival the greatest show in the world will be held on Monday 7th and Tuesday 8th March 2011. This period is anticipated by all involved from the costume designer to the wire bender, the calypso song writers to the performers, the promoters to the street vendors, and masqueraders as they wait the displaying of their colourful attire. These are the factors that are fast becoming the representation of the carnival culture, and the traditional aspect being forgotten.
Libraries have a critical role to play in educating and enriching its users, with information and resources about traditional carnival season. By promoting and displaying images of carnival characters like Baby Doll, Dame Lorraine and Fancy Clown to name a few, also showcasing the importance and the influence of the Camboulay Riot to carnival, and paying tribute to the evolution of calypso and calypsonians.
